Cost Factors for Hiring Movers in Boston
The cost of hiring movers in Boston can vary widely based on several factors. Understanding these factors can help you budget effectively for your move.
Breakdown of Moving Costs
Costs associated with hiring movers typically include:
- Distance: Longer moves typically incur higher costs due to transportation fees.
- Size of Move: The more items you have, the higher the cost, as it requires more time and effort.
- Seasonality: Rates can fluctuate based on the season, with summer typically being the busiest time for movers.
- Services Required: Additional services like packing, storage, and heavy item movement can increase costs.

Understanding Moving Estimates
Movers will provide estimates based on the information you provide. Familiarize yourself with the different types of estimates:
- Binding Estimate: A fixed price based on the initial inventory list. The price cannot increase, barring additional services.
- Non-binding Estimate: An estimate based on an initial assessment of the move. The final price could vary based on actual items moved.
- Binding Not-to-Exceed Estimate: Guarantees that the final price will be lower than or equal to the estimate, providing some flexibility.

Common Challenges Faced
Movers in Boston can encounter several challenges, including:
- Logistical issues such as limited parking and narrow streets, particularly in downtown areas.
- Unforeseen weather conditions that can delay moving schedules.
- Inefficient packing, leading to longer loading times and potential damage to fragile items.
